If you are young and want to come across as a convincing elderly person, you can improve your costume or acting by getting started with make-up. Applying makeup to look older may seem complicated, but it's actually quite easy. You only need a few makeup products and tools to create an older looking face and you can achieve an elderly look in just a few minutes.

Part 1 of 3: Sharpen your facial features and create wrinkles

  1. Get the materials. Before you start, you need to grab some special items. You need:
    • Foundation
    • Dark brown eyeshadow
    • Medium brown eyeshadow
    • Light brown eyeshadow
    • Make-up brushes and sponges
    • Matte pink or nude lipstick or lip pencil
    • Highlighter
  2. Apply a layer of foundation. Start with a clean and dry face and then apply a coat of foundation all over your face. This way you create an even surface for the makeup for the elderly. Use some liquid foundation and fix it with a layer of translucent powder.
    • Apply the liquid make-up to your entire face with a make-up sponge, then blend the make-up with the same sponge.
    • Finish the layer of foundation with a layer of translucent powder.
  3. Make crow's feet. Once you are done creating some basic wrinkles on your face, you can start strengthening the wrinkles around your eyes and nose. Start making crow's feet. You do this by drawing a few lines from the outer edge of your eyes outward.
    • Use eyeshadow or eyeliner to draw these lines. Stretch the lines and away from the eyes.
    • Pinch your eyes to identify the natural folds in your skin next to your eyes. You can then simply fill in these lines with eyeshadow or eyeliner.
    • Blur the lines gently.
  4. Apply a coat of matte pink lipstick or lip pencil. Then you apply a layer of matte pink or nude lip color. This is how you create a surface for creating wrinkled lips. Apply a coat of lipstick or lip pencil of your choice.
    • Don't go beyond the lines of your lips. It's okay if your lips look a little thin.
  5. Create wrinkles on your lips with a highlighter. Pucker up your lips and apply some highlighter to finish them off. Apply some highlighter to the areas of your pursed lips that stand out the most. Dab the highlighter on these areas with a brush or make-up sponge.
    • When you relax your lips, they should look wrinkled.
